On the carousel – Rai Movie, 21:10
Directed by: Georgia Cesere
Cast: Claudia Gerini, Lucia Sardo, Alessio Vassallo, Paolo Sasanelli
Year: 2021
Sinopsys: Irene is a beautiful and successful woman: in fact, after graduating, she left the Salento countryside and moved to Rome, where she worked hard to start a production company. A teenage son and an absent ex-husband also keep her days busy. When her mother decides to sell the family villa, Irene plans to use her share of the proceeds to get through a moment of economic hardship. But something unexpected happens: Ada, the old housekeeper, refuses to leave the house. Thus, Irene is forced to return to the village that has always been by her side and face an archaic dimension that no longer belongs to her.
Top Gun: Maverick – Sky Cinema Uno, 21:15
Directed by: Joseph Kosinsky
Cast: Tom Cruise, Miles Teller, Jennifer Connelly, Jon Hamm, Glen Powell, Lewis Pullman, Charles Parnell, Bashir Salahuddin, Monica Barbaro, Jay Ellis, Danny Ramirez, Greg Tarzan Davis, Ed Harris, Val Kilmer
Year: 2022
Plot: After more than thirty years of service, Lt. Pete “Maverick” Mitchell, one of the Navy’s top aviators, avoids a promotion that would no longer allow him to fly and pushes (once again) beyond the limits by courageously testing new planes. Called to train a special team of Top Gun Academy students for a secret mission, Maverick will face Lieutenant “Rooster” Bradley Bradshaw, the son of his old partner Nick “Goose” Bradshaw. Maverick will have to contend not only with an uncertain future, but also with the ghosts of his past.
